About ALI
The overarching aim of ALI is to support and accelerate activities that positively impact aquatic life. Working in tandem with certifiers, industry professionals, existing nonprofits, and legislators, ALI is a central and pivotal organization in efforts to (1) improve the welfare of farmed aquatic animals globally and (2) reduce the number of wild fish used for feed and reduce their suffering at the time of catch.
